Lido Founder Borrows 85 Million USDT from Aave to Purchase ETH

By: theblockbeats.news|2025/07/29 04:42:27

BlockBeats News, July 29th, according to LookIntoChain monitoring, Lido founder Konstantin Lomashuk borrowed 85 million USDT from Aave to purchase ETH.


He borrowed 85 million USDT from Aave and then transferred 80 million USDT to Amber Group.


Amber Group deposited 80 million USDT to the trading platform and withdrew 15,814 ETH (59.75 million USD) from the trading platform.
